The core product segments encompass comprehensive labor scheduling, time tracking, compliance management, and workforce analytics modules tailored for manufacturing environments. Key stakeholders include original equipment manufacturers (OEMs), software vendors, system integrators, and end-user enterprises across manufacturing, automotive, aerospace, and electronics sectors. The supply-side structure features a mix of established global vendors and niche providers, often collaborating with hardware suppliers and cloud service providers to enhance platform capabilities. Demand segmentation primarily targets large-scale manufacturers seeking enterprise-wide solutions, alongside small and medium enterprises adopting modular, scalable systems. Regulatory frameworks around labor standards, safety, and data privacy influence product design and deployment strategies. The competitive ecosystem is characterized by intense innovation, strategic alliances, and frequent product upgrades to meet evolving industry needs.
The value chain begins with sourcing raw data inputs from payroll systems, IoT sensors, and manual inputs. These inputs undergo processing through software modules that facilitate workforce scheduling, compliance tracking, and productivity analysis. Distribution channels include direct sales, channel partners, and cloud-based SaaS platforms accessible via subscription models. Revenue streams predominantly derive from licensing fees, subscription charges, and value-added services such as consulting and customization. After-sales support, ongoing system updates, and lifecycle management are critical components of revenue, ensuring sustained customer engagement and compliance adherence. Integration with existing ERP, MES, and HR systems is essential for seamless operational workflows, emphasizing the importance of scalable and interoperable solutions.
System integration within the PLMS ecosystem involves connecting labor management platforms with enterprise resource planning (ERP), manufacturing execution systems (MES), and human capital management (HCM) solutions to enable end-to-end visibility. Technology interoperability is facilitated through open APIs, standardized data formats, and cloud-based architectures, allowing cross-platform functionality. Cross-industry collaborations, such as partnerships with IoT device manufacturers and AI providers, enhance system capabilities and data richness. Digital transformation initiatives are driving the adoption of integrated, intelligent labor management solutions that support real-time decision-making. Infrastructure compatibility across diverse manufacturing environments ensures deployment flexibility, while standardization trends promote data consistency and ease of integration across vendors and platforms.
The cost structure of PLMS solutions typically comprises fixed costs related to software development, licensing, and infrastructure setup, alongside variable costs associated with ongoing maintenance, support, and updates. Capital expenditure trends favor cloud-based SaaS models, reducing upfront investments and enabling scalable deployment. Industry average operating margins for leading providers range between 20% and 35%, reflecting high-margin SaaS revenue streams. Risk exposure includes data breaches, compliance violations, and system downtime, which can impact reputation and operational continuity. Compliance costs are significant, especially for solutions operating in regulated sectors like aerospace and automotive. Pricing strategies are increasingly shifting toward subscription-based models with tiered offerings to accommodate diverse customer needs and budgets.
